Senior Assistant Caseworker, Office Support

The Office of Child and Family Services is seeking a motivated and detail-oriented Senior Assistant Caseworker, Office Support, to help maintain efficient office operations within a child welfare setting. This position requires strong organizational skills, professionalism, and the ability to work in a fast-paced environment while supporting staff, clients, and community partners. The ideal candidate will be dependable, customer service focused, and capable of managing a variety of administrative responsibilities with accuracy and confidentiality.

Key Responsibilities

A Senior Assistant Caseworker, Office Support, serves as a clerical resource to professional child welfare social work staff by providing direct client and case related support services. Duties include taking and distributing meeting minutes, answering phones, greeting visitors and clients, completing Clear Search requests, assisting with supervised visits, transporting youth and clients, maintaining files and records, preparing court and client documentation, processing financial transactions, and assisting with additional office and case support functions as assigned.
